One of my favorite combinations---historical fiction and a murder mystery. Set in the mid 1800's London, the main character is Charles Lennox, a typical Victorian gentleman and bachelor---second son of nobility who financially does not have to 'work' for a living. He spends his time in pursuit of his hobbies which include travel, archaeology, history and of course, sleuthing. Charles Lenox is an amateur detective living in Victorian England. His dear friend and next door neighbor, Jane, asks him to investigate the death of her former maid Prudence. Charles discovers she was killed with a rare poison. The suspects are limited to the residents of George Barnard's house. I liked the main character and the others who help him solve the case.
